Lebanon's new president strikes a nationalistic tone amid regional shifts, further weakening of Hezbollah
Friday, January 10th 2025, 11:21:17 am
article
The Lebanese parliament finally voted on a new president on Thursday following two years of deadlock. Joseph Aoun the head of the country's armed forces won a majority of the votes.
